Ukrop's, Pick 'n Save, Add Fuel Discounts to Loyalty Programs

Ukrop’s and Pick ‘n Save are the latest grocers to get cracking in the fuel discount movement, when last week they began new loyalty marketing programs tied to gasoline purchases in an effort to help consumers stretch their dollars in today’s tough economic climate.

Ukrop’s will run the program at 25 stores in the Richmond, Virginia area. Roundy’s Supermarkets, owner and operator of the Pic ‘n Save, is piloting the program through September 10.

“Fuelperks! is the most ambitious customer loyalty and rewards program since the launch of our Ukrop’s Valued Customer Card in 1987,” said Bobby Ukrop, president and c.e.o. of Ukrop’s. “Rising fuel prices impact everyone from young adults to families to seniors on fixed incomes. Fuelperks! is an effort to help Richmonders stretch their grocery and gas dollars.”

The fuelperks! program will allow Ukrop’s customers to save 10 cents per gallon for every $50 they spend using their Ukrop’s Valued Customer (UVC) card.

Pick ‘n Save shoppers receive the same benefits when they spend $50 using their Roundy’s Rewards card. To redeem the rewards, members swipe their loyalty cards at participating fuel locations, and the price of the gas automatically rolls down to the reduced price. 

Richmond, Va.-based Ukrop's operates 28 retail food stores, Joe's Market (a regional specialty market), a central bakery and kitchen, and a distribution center.

Roundy's Supermarkets, Inc., Milwaukee, Wis. operates 152 retail grocery stores under the Pick 'n Save, Copps, Rainbow, and Metro Market banners in Wisconsin and Minnesota.
